URIZAP IS described as a world-first development specifically designed as a single-step sustainable solution that digests, and prevents the build-up of uric acid scale, while eliminating odours.

Urine contains compounds such as uric acid, struvite (‘urine stone’) and potassium phosphate, that precipitate, causing blockages in urinal pipes, and persistent unpleasant odours, which need expensive fixes.
The trend to install waterless/low flush urinals exacerbates these issues and current treatments rely on a cocktail of bleaches, descalers, enzymes, disinfectants, urinal pods or mats and air fresheners to mask lingering odours. These don’t work to eliminate build-up and eventually lead to pipework replacement, which can be expensive and time-consuming.

Overall, our extensive trials have demonstrated that when applied to 1,000 urinals, URIZAP can save 25 tonnes of CO2 per year.
Just one 25 gram scoop of URIZAP contains billions of beneficial bacteria that digests limescale and uric acid build-up . Applied weekly with one cup of water is all that is required to maintain each urinal free of odours, blockages and costly repairs - minimising disruptions and overheads, while maximising infrastructure longevity – ensuring the highest-quality service.
